In the competitive world of CS2, mastering the perfect headshot is essential for gaining an edge over your opponents. To achieve this, positioning plays a crucial role. Firstly, consider your map awareness; knowing the layout and typical player movements allows you to anticipate enemy positions. Utilize cover effectively by positioning yourself behind objects, maintaining a clear line of sight while minimizing your exposure. Additionally, take advantage of high ground whenever possible—this not only provides a better angle for your shots but also makes you a harder target to hit.
Another key strategy for achieving the optimal headshot involves understanding different weapon mechanics. For instance, some weapons may have a higher accuracy when stationary versus while moving. Experiment with different stances; crouching can increase your precision, especially during long-range engagements. Lastly, practice consistently in a controlled environment or through dedicated training maps. By honing your skills and perfecting your positioning strategies, you will significantly improve your headshot ratio, making you a more formidable player in CS2.

Another critical aspect of using cover to your advantage in CS2 is understanding the map layout. Familiarize yourself with common choke points and high-traffic areas where engagements are likely to occur. This knowledge allows you to position yourself strategically behind cover, making it easier to catch enemies off guard. Additionally, consider the use of smokes and flashes to create temporary cover or disrupt enemy lines of sight. Remember, the goal is to minimize your risk while maximizing your chances for a successful headshot, which ultimately can turn the tide of a match in your favor.
